Tumwater to Spokane

Updated: 28 May 2026

The journey from Tumwater to Spokane spans approximately 300 miles across the state of Washington. You can drive via I-5 North to I-90 East, crossing the Cascade Mountains. Alternatively, you can drive to SeaTac Airport and take a short flight to Spokane International Airport. The drive offers spectacular mountain scenery, while flying is significantly faster. Plan for mountain pass conditions during winter months.

Total Distance: 480 km driving distance, 400 km straight-line air distance.
Fastest Way
Flying from SeaTac, including the drive to the airport.
Cheapest Way
Driving your own vehicle is the most cost-effective for multiple passengers.

Travel Tips
  • Mountain Passes
    Always carry tire chains or have AWD when crossing Snoqualmie Pass in winter.
  • Fuel Stops
    Fill up in Ellensburg or Moses Lake; gas prices can be higher in remote areas.
  • Airport Parking
    Use long-term parking at SeaTac if flying; book in advance to save.
  • Time Zone
    All of Washington is in the Pacific Time Zone.
  • Weather
    Spokane has more extreme seasonal temperatures than Western Washington.

Things to Do in Spokane
1
Riverfront Park
Visit the site of the 1974 World's Fair. It features the iconic Pavilion and the Spokane Falls.
2
Manito Park
Explore 78 acres of beautiful gardens, including the Duncan Garden and the Gaiser Conservatory.
3
Centennial Trail
Walk or bike along this 40-mile trail that follows the Spokane River.
4
Mobius Discovery Center
A great interactive science museum for families and children.
